Brazilian sanitation firm Aegea issues blue bond
09/29/2025 Since 1 month
Aegea, a private water and sanitation company operating in nearly 900 municipalities in 15 states in Brazil and serving over 39 million people, announced the issuance of a 10-year term blue bond in the international capital markets for a total amount of 750 million dollars, representing the largest worldwide corporate blue bond placement.
The operation was over-subscribed by about 5x the original base offer (of 500 million dollars), attracting 2.4 billion dollars. The resources obtained from the blue bond issuance will be allocated to eligible projects in the blue category of the Company’s Sustainable Finance Framework.
